Though there are many to choose from, one restaurant in Nebraska serves up the best soup around.

According to a list compiled by Eat This Not That, the best soup in Nebraska can be found at Railcar Modern American Kitchen located in Omaha. Eat This Not That recommended trying the french onion soup.

Here is what Eat This Not That had to say about the best soup in all of Nebraska:

"Found off of a main road in Omaha's Lindenwood neighborhood is Railcar Modern American Kitchen, a welcoming downhome cookery that makes all of their food from scratch. A must-try on their menu is the French onion soup, a savory soup made with roasted chicken stock, white wine, and a gruyere cheese blend."
